Abstract

The utility model discloses a pier stud protection net system for municipal bridge engineering, wherein a protection net is fixedly arranged on the surface of a protection door, an outdoor infrared alarm is fixedly arranged at the top of a fixed rod on one side of a support rod, a sealing box is fixedly arranged on one side of the fixed rod on one side of a coded lock, a solar charging panel is fixedly arranged at the top of the fixed rod on the other side of the support rod, a control box is fixedly arranged on the surface of the fixed rod on the other side of the support rod, a connecting piece is fixedly arranged between the fixed rods at two ends of the fixing piece, and a screw is fixedly arranged between the connecting piece and the fixing piece. The utility model can firstly use the coded lock to swipe the card and press the password to control the outdoor infrared alarm in the using process of the device through arranging a series of structures, so that the alarm can not be given when internal personnel input the password, and then the outdoor infrared alarm is used to prevent external personnel from entering.

Pier column protective net system for municipal bridge engineering
Technical Field
The utility model relates to the technical field of bridge engineering, in particular to a pier stud protection network system for municipal bridge engineering.
Background
Pier stud, the lower bearing weight that is used for bearing superstructure in civil engineering. The cross section of the pier column is circular, and the pier column also has anisotropic pier columns such as ellipse, square, curve and parabola. The method is an important component in the projects of bridges such as highway bridges, railway bridges, sidewalks, overpasses, ramp bridges, overpasses and the like.
The existing pier stud protection network system of the municipal bridge engineering has the following defects:
1. tools or raw materials are easy to fall off during construction of the pier stud protective net system of the municipal bridge engineering, accidents are easy to happen when irrelevant personnel stay beside, and the problem of steel bar theft is easy to happen;
2. the stability and the safety of the pier stud protection network system of the municipal bridge engineering are required to be improved, and the pier stud protection network system for the municipal bridge engineering is inconvenient to disassemble and assemble, so that the existing problems are solved.

Referring to fig. 1-4, an embodiment of the present invention is shown: a pier stud protection network system for municipal bridge engineering comprises a base 4, supporting rods 6 and a protection door 8, wherein fixed rods 10 are fixedly installed at the top of the base 4, the fixed rods 10 play a fixing role, the supporting rods 6 are fixedly installed between the fixed rods 10, the protection door 8 is movably installed between the supporting rods 6 between the fixed rods 10 and the base 4 through a hinge shaft 802, the protection door 8 can be rotated through rotating the hinge shaft 802, a protection net 11 is fixedly installed on the surface of the protection door 8, the protection net 11 plays a protection role so as to prevent foreign people from entering, an outdoor infrared alarm 1 is fixedly installed at the top of the fixed rod 10 on one side of the supporting rods 6, the outdoor infrared alarm 1 adopts a K1 model, the outdoor infrared alarm 1 can prevent foreign people from entering at will and climbing on the protection net, the outdoor infrared alarm 1 can immediately give an alarm through being connected with devices such as a mobile phone and the like, therefore, the inconvenience brought by manpower guard is saved while the intrusion of foreign people is prevented, the coded lock 2 is fixedly arranged on the surface of the fixing rod 10 on one side of the supporting rod 6, the coded lock 2 adopts a ZC-KY101 model, the coded lock 2 can control the outdoor infrared alarm 1 by swiping a card and pressing a password, so that the alarm cannot be given out when the internal people input the password, the sealing box 301 is fixedly arranged on one side of the fixing rod 10 on one side of the coded lock 2, the sealing box 301 plays a role in sealing, the solar charging panel 7 is fixedly arranged on the top of the fixing rod 10 on the other side of the supporting rod 6, the solar energy can be converted into electric energy by the solar charging panel 7, the control box 9 is fixedly arranged on the surface of the fixing rod 10 on the other side of the supporting rod 6, and the control box 9 can be respectively and electrically connected with the outdoor infrared alarm 1 and the coded lock 2 by wires, thereby more make things convenient for the user of service to use the device, the inside of dead lever 10 is provided with inner chamber 1001, fixed mounting has safety net 13 between the dead lever 10 of bracing piece 6 both sides, safety net 13 can play the effect of protection, both ends mounting 1202 of safety net 13, fixed mounting has connecting piece 12 between the dead lever 10 at mounting 1202 both ends, and fixed mounting has screw 1201 between connecting piece 12 and the mounting 1202, coincide mutually through mounting 1202 and connecting piece 12, alternate screw 1201 between connecting piece 12 and mounting 1202, thereby make things convenient for the staff to the dismantlement and the change of safety net 13.
Further, the inside outdoor infrared alarm 1 bottom fixed mounting of inner chamber 1001 has support frame 101, and the bottom fixed mounting of support frame 101 has limiting plate 102, fixes support frame 101 in the inside of inner chamber 1001 through utilizing limiting plate 102, fixes outdoor infrared alarm 1 on support frame 101 to strengthen outdoor infrared alarm 1's steadiness.
Further, the inside fixed mounting of seal box 301 has storage battery 3, and the dead lever 10 one side fixed mounting of storage battery 3 bottom has mount 302, and mount 302 can play fixed effect, and storage battery 3 can supply power to outdoor infrared alarm 1, trick lock 2 and control box 9.
Further, the bottom fixed mounting of solar charging panel 7 has fixed plate 702, and the both sides fixed mounting of fixed plate 702 has bolt 701, and fixed plate 702 can play fixed effect, and bolt 701 can be fixed with fixed plate 702 to strengthen whole device's stability.
Further, a connecting plate 801 is fixedly installed on the surface of the protection net 11, a handle 803 is fixedly installed on the surface of the connecting plate 801, the protection door 8 can be pushed open through the handle 803, and therefore the protection door 8 can be conveniently opened and closed by workers.
Further, a fixing pin 5 is fixedly installed outside the fixing rod 10 at the bottom of the base 4, the fixing pin 5 penetrates through the base 4, and the base 4 can be penetrated through the fixing pin 5, so that firmness of the whole device is enhanced.
The working principle is as follows: when in use, the outdoor infrared alarm 1 and the coded lock 2 can be respectively and electrically connected with the outdoor infrared alarm 1 and the coded lock 2 by wires through the control box 9, then the outdoor infrared alarm 1 is fixedly arranged at the top of the fixing rod 10 at one side of the supporting rod 6, the outdoor infrared alarm 1 can prevent external personnel from randomly entering and climbing on a protection net, the outdoor infrared alarm 1 can immediately give an alarm by connecting equipment such as a mobile phone, so that the inconvenience brought by manpower guard is saved while the external personnel are prevented from entering, then the coded lock 2 is fixedly arranged on the surface of the fixing rod 10 at one side of the supporting rod 6, the coded lock 2 can control the outdoor infrared alarm 1 by swiping a card and pressing a code, so that the internal personnel cannot give an alarm when inputting the code, and finally the protection door 8 is movably arranged between the supporting rod 6 between the fixing rods 10 and the base 4 through the hinge shaft 802, the guard door 8 is rotated by rotating the hinge shaft 802 to open the door.
